Flu season sets record for pediatric deaths

27 children died from flu

DETROIT – This flu season has already set a record for pediatric deaths.

Through Dec. 28, 27 children were confirmed to have died from the flu. That’s the highest number at this point in the season since the Center for Disease Control and Prevention started tracking pediatric deaths 17 years ago.
